|
From: Hedayat V. <hed...@ai...> - 2008-02-20 12:05:41
|
<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html style="direction: ltr;">
<head>
<meta content="text/html;charset=UTF-8" http-equiv="Content-Type">
</head>
<body style="direction: ltr;" bgcolor="#ffffff" text="#000000">
<span><br>
<br>
<style type="text/css">blockquote {color: navy !important; background-color: RGB(245,245,245) !important; padding: 0 15 10 15 !important; margin: 15 0 0 0; border-left: #1010ff 2px solid;} blockquote blockquote {color: maroon !important; background-color: RGB(235,235,235) !important; border-left-color:maroon !important} blockquote blockquote blockquote {color: green !important; background-color: RGB(225,225,225) !important; border-left-color:teal !important} blockquote blockquote blockquote blockquote {color: purple !important; background-color: RGB(215,215,215) !important; border-left-color: purple !important} blockquote blockquote blockquote blockquote blockquote {color: teal !important; background-color: RGB(205,205,205) !important; border-left-color: green !important}</style><i><b>"Yuan
Xu" <a class="moz-txt-link-rfc2396E" href="mailto:xuy...@gm..."><xuy...@gm...></a></b></i> wrote on 02/20/2008 11:29:27 AM:</span><br>
<blockquote style="border-left: 2px solid rgb(16, 16, 255); color: navy; background-color: rgb(245, 245, 245); padding-left: 15px;" cite="mid:18a...@ma..." type="cite">
<pre wrap="">Hi Hedayat,
</pre>
</blockquote>
Hi,<br>
<blockquote style="border-left: 2px solid rgb(16, 16, 255); color: navy; background-color: rgb(245, 245, 245); padding-left: 15px;" cite="mid:18a...@ma..." type="cite">
<pre wrap="">
In my system, the external monitor works when only one agent and all
programs in one machine.
But when another robot connects, the monitor will stoped ;-(
</pre>
</blockquote>
Yes, I didn't test the external monitor connecting from another system.
<br>
<blockquote style="border-left: 2px solid rgb(16, 16, 255); color: navy; background-color: rgb(245, 245, 245); padding-left: 15px;" cite="mid:18a...@ma..." type="cite">
<pre wrap="">
I think it is not only the problem of monitorspark, since we have
implemented a monitor ourselves,
the problem is the same: the monitor only receive the message "NULL".
BTW, should we need the external monitor run in multi-threads?
</pre>
</blockquote>
No, I don't think so! It was just a simple experiment to know why it
crashes in that mode. <br>
<br>
<blockquote style="border-left: 2px solid rgb(16, 16, 255); color: navy; background-color: rgb(245, 245, 245); padding-left: 15px;" cite="mid:18a...@ma..." type="cite">
<pre wrap="">I think the changes you made may mess the design.
</pre>
</blockquote>
If you mean the changes to SparkMonitor, I didn't commit it. I did a
small test and I thought that it might worth noting!<br>
But if you are talking about the multi-threaded implementation I
committed, please explain more. I don't know why it could mess the
design. <br>
<br>
Thanks,<br>
Hedayat<br>
<br>
<blockquote style="border-left: 2px solid rgb(16, 16, 255); color: navy; background-color: rgb(245, 245, 245); padding-left: 15px;" cite="mid:18a...@ma..." type="cite">
<pre wrap="">
2008/2/20, Hedayat Vatankhah <a class="moz-txt-link-rfc2396E" href="mailto:hed...@ai..."><hed...@ai...></a>:
</pre>
<blockquote type="cite">
<pre wrap=""> Hi,
I'm agree! :)
And about external monitor, I can successfully run the external monitor in
multi-threaded mode by renaming SparkMonitorClient's StartCycle to EndCycle.
(Like RenderControl, it should needs to be run in the main thread to prevent
crash). I have not tested much to see if it works fine, but in some very
simple tests it works just like the internal monitor. The only issue is that
it crashes on quit.
Have a nice time,
Hedayat
"Yuan Xu" <a class="moz-txt-link-rfc2396E" href="mailto:xuy...@gm..."><xuy...@gm...></a> wrote on 02/19/2008 08:29:15 PM:
Hi Joschka,
It is well organized. The schedule is clear, I think.
The date to release rcssserver3d-0.5.7 is coming,
maybe we should make a alpha package firstly, and test it by MC members.
Let's make decision which features/patches should be included in 0.5.7.
As you have mentioned, simRate, multithreading + internal rendering
should be included.
And also communication, Composite bodies?
I also hope I can make the external monitor working these days.
2008/2/19, <a class="moz-txt-link-abbreviated" href="mailto:jos...@go...">jos...@go...</a>
<a class="moz-txt-link-rfc2396E" href="mailto:jos...@go..."><jos...@go...></a>:
Hey guys, I've shared this item with you using Google Docs. To open
it, just click the link below. It's not too organized right now and I'm
not sure if the schedule is realistic, but it's a start. Let's keep
moving quickly on this, time's quite advanced already.
Cheers,
Joschka
RoboCup Soccer Simulation Maintenance...
<a class="moz-txt-link-freetext" href="http://docs.google.com/Doc?id=djkzvqh_3d8w7g6cx&invite=">http://docs.google.com/Doc?id=djkzvqh_3d8w7g6cx&invite=</a>
</pre>
</blockquote>
<pre wrap=""><!---->
</pre>
</blockquote>
</body>
</html>
|